What Is the Anterior Portion of the Sclera?

The sclera itself is a three-layered structure, but the anterior portion refers specifically to the front third of this tissue. Plus, it’s the thickest and most solid section, packed with collagen fibers that give it strength. This area starts at the limbus—the border between the sclera and the cornea—and extends back toward the optic nerve.

Anatomically, the anterior sclera is tightly bonded to the cornea via the corneal-scleral junction. The anterior portion also houses the anterior chamber angle, a narrow space where the cornea and sclera meet. Day to day, this connection is crucial because it allows the eye to maintain its spherical shape while enabling smooth movement. This angle is a hotspot for fluid drainage in the eye, making it a key player in conditions like glaucoma.

Functionally, the anterior sclera acts as a shock absorber. When you blink, squint, or even sneeze, this layer dampens the force of those movements. It also serves as an attachment point for the extraocular muscles—six muscles that let you look up, down, left, right, and everywhere in between. Without the anterior sclera’s structural integrity, these muscles couldn’t transmit force effectively, leaving your gaze floppy and uncoordinated.

Here’s a quick breakdown of its roles:

  • Structural support: Maintains the eye’s round shape.
    Also, - Muscle attachment: Anchors the muscles that control eye movement. Think about it: - Protection: Shields inner structures from trauma and pathogens. - Fluid dynamics: Houses the drainage system that regulates eye pressure.

In short, the anterior sclera is the eye’s foundation. It’s not flashy, but without it, the rest of the visual system would be in chaos.


Why the Anterior Sclera Matters for Eye Health

Let’s get real: The anterior sclera is often overlooked in everyday conversations about eye health. But here’s the truth—it’s ground zero for many common eye conditions. Take glaucoma, for example. This sight-stealing disease is often linked to increased intraocular pressure, which can damage the optic nerve. Here's the thing — the anterior sclera plays a direct role here because it’s part of the eye’s drainage system. If the angle where the sclera meets the cornea becomes blocked, fluid can’t exit properly, leading to pressure buildup.

Then there’s scleritis, an inflammatory condition that targets the sclera. But why does this happen? In practice, when the anterior portion gets inflamed, it can cause pain, redness, and even vision loss if left untreated. The good news? Early detection and treatment can prevent serious complications. Because the anterior sclera is so exposed—it’s the first line of defense against infections, UV radiation, and physical trauma.

Another angle (pun intended) is eye surgery. Procedures like LASIK or cataract removal involve cutting into the cornea, which is tightly fused to the anterior sclera. That said, surgeons must deal with this junction carefully to avoid damaging the scleral tissue. A slip here could lead to leaks, infections, or even a condition called scleral detachment, where the sclera peels away from the underlying layers.

Let’s not forget trauma. Whether it’s a sports injury, a foreign object, or a blunt force hit, the anterior sclera is often the first to bear the brunt. Its thick collagen layers can withstand a lot, but deep wounds or punctures can compromise its integrity. In severe cases, this might require surgical repair to prevent long-term damage.

Bottom line: The anterior sclera isn’t just a passive layer—it’s a dynamic, multifunctional structure that impacts everything from eye pressure to surgical outcomes. Neglecting it could mean missing the root cause of serious eye problems.


How the Anterior Sclera Works: A Behind-the-Scenes Look

Now that we’ve covered its importance, let’s unpack how the anterior sclera actually functions. Think of it as the eye’s suspension system—it keeps everything aligned while absorbing daily stresses. Here’s the science behind it:

  1. Collagen and Elastin: The sclera is packed with these proteins, which give it both strength and flexibility. The anterior portion has the highest collagen density, making it the toughest part of the sclera.
  2. Muscle Attachments: Six extraocular muscles (like the rectus and oblique muscles) anchor into the anterior sclera. These muscles contract and relax to move the eye in all directions. Without this anchor, your gaze would be as unsteady as a ship in a storm.
  3. Corneal Connection: The sclera and cornea are fused at the limbus. This bond is so strong that surgeons use it as a guide during procedures. A weak or damaged junction can lead to corneal displacement or vision distortion.
  4. Fluid Regulation: The anterior chamber angle, located at the scleral-corneal junction, is where aqueous humor (the eye’s nourishing fluid) drains. If this angle narrows or clogs, pressure rises—cue glaucoma.

But here’s where it gets tricky: The anterior sclera isn’t static. It’s constantly adapting to your movements and environmental factors. Also, for instance, when you stare at a screen for hours, the muscles attached to the sclera fatigue, leading to eye strain. Or when you’re exposed to wind or dust, the sclera’s protective role kicks into overdrive, sometimes causing dryness or irritation.

Protecting the Anterior Sclera: Practical Steps

  • Mindful Blinking: Consciously blink fully every 10–15 minutes during screen work to replenish the tear film and reduce shear stress on the scleral‑corneal junction.
  • Protective Eyewear: UV‑blocking sunglasses or wraparound goggles shield the anterior sclera from phototoxic damage and particulate irritation, especially in high‑glare or dusty environments.
  • Hydration and Nutrition: Adequate water intake and a diet rich in omega‑3 fatty acids, vitamin C, and zinc support collagen synthesis and maintain the sclera’s tensile strength.
  • Regular Eye Exams: Slit‑lamp examinations can detect early scleral thinning, limbal inflammation, or abnormal muscle insertion tension before they manifest as vision problems.
  • Prompt Treatment of Irritation: Over‑the‑counter lubricants or prescribed anti‑inflammatory drops should be used at the first sign of persistent discomfort; delaying care can allow inflammation to extend deeper into the scleral stroma.
